What you'll do
- Develop and prioritize overall GTM strategy, ensuring alignment across digital channels and business objectives
- Lead DTC (Direct-to-Consumer) positioning strategy across all consumer touchpoints, translating business goals into actionable digital campaigns
- Drive digital campaign strategy and execution, including paid media, email, social, and emerging channels
- Develop and execute influencer partnership strategies to amplify campaign reach and engagement
- Lead agency collaboration and manage creative approvals, ensuring timely delivery of high-quality assets
- Own end-to-end paid digital execution with our digital agency partners
- Conduct regular campaign performance analysis and provide actionable optimization insights to improve channel performance and ROI
- Develop compelling value propositions and messaging that resonate with target audiences across digital channels
- Partner with cross-functional stakeholders, including Product, Sales, and Analytics teams, to execute integrated digital campaigns that drive business growth
- Manage multiple digital campaigns simultaneously while balancing priorities, meeting deadlines, and staying on budget
- Provide strategic input for GTM initiatives and new service launches
- Stay current with digital marketing trends, platform updates, and best practices to continuously improve campaign effectiveness
Qualifications
What you bring
- University degree or diploma in Marketing, Communications, Business, or related field
- 7+ years of experience in digital marketing, campaign management, performance marketing, or integrated marketing
- Proven experience managing paid digital campaigns across multiple platforms (Google Ads, Meta, LinkedIn, etc.)
- Experience with influencer marketing and partnership strategy
- Strong experience with marketing analytics, campaign reporting, and data-driven optimization
- Previous experience at a digital agency or in-house marketing team is preferred
- Experience in healthcare or regulated industries is an asset
- Excellent project management, interpersonal, and stakeholder management skills
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to translate data into actionable insights
- Comfortable managing competing priorities and working under tight deadlines
- Proficiency with marketing automation and analytics tools
- Fluent in English; French bilingualism is a strong asset
